Stefan Bertin, Celebrity Hairstylist. The three most common flat iron plates are ceramic , tourmaline and titanium. Each one will straighten hair, but different attributes make each more beneficial for certain hair textures, ranging from fine wavy hair to kinky coils. Bertin said that ceramic irons are the most affordable option out of the three types of hair straighteners. According to the pros, tourmaline plates contain silicate and straighten the hair with less heat.
Titanium is a strong, durable metal best suited for professional salon use, said Bertin. We consulted experts and found 11 celebrity hairstylist-approved flat irons in various price points. Although titanium is similar to tourmaline, it heats faster and more evenly, and is also the longest-lasting because it is a metal instead of a gemstone, says Stenson. Due to its even and extra-hot settings, titanium can't be beat when it comes to styling hair that is typically hard to straighten.
However, Johnson warns that these higher temperatures that titanium tools reach can be damaging to hair if used improperly. She therefore does not recommend that fine hair opt for this type of hot-tool. Regardless of what type of tool you end up choosing though, remember to always use a heat protectant to keep your hair healthy while you style it. By Miki Hayes.
